Legitimate sweepstakes and promotions never ask winners to pay anything before receiving a prize, and taxes are always paid directly to the IRS after receipt of winnings. Some signs that a sweepstakes site is a scaminclude requiring proof of purchase without an alternate entry method, charging an entry fee, and promising you better chances to win if you make a purchase. A good privacy policy tells you why the company needs the information that they collect from you and what they'll do with it.
